Sinopec offers free rides for migrant workers

By Zheng Xin | China Daily | Updated: 2017-01-05 07:44

Oil giant aims to make festival trip home better, safer and more pleasant

Tens of thousands of migrant workers going home by motorcycle or minibus during the upcoming annual travel rush will get a lift. They will be offered free refueling services by Sinopec's subsidiaries in Guangdong province and the Guangxi Zhuang autonomous region, starting from Jan 13.

A total of 10,000 free "refueling packages", including a free pump, accident insurance and warm clothes and a few snacks, will also be sent to motorists.
